Hmmm what is that emule's ipfilter.dat, expand please so I can get the best out of using BitComet =P

it blocks "bad IPs"

download and unzip http://emulepawcio.sourceforge.net/nieuwe_...es/ipfilter.zip to C:\Program Files\BitComet\rules and restart bitcomet (if running)

you should repeat that action when you want to update it.

once a week/month depending on your level of paranoia ;)

also make sure you have ipfilter enabled in the bitcomet settings

but keep in mind it offers zero protection from the "bad guys" from knowing what youre downloading or hiding your IP from them as the trackers will still tell them, but it will keep "them" from sending bad data chunks

If you would like something simple I would recommend Arctic Torrent.

Screenshot

A minimal BitTorrent client. It wont have all the pretty features that other Torrent apps have, but focuses on low memory and cpu usage. Because it was written in C++, you dont get the high memory requirements of Java or high CPU usage of Python.
